Peat, Palm and Haze

The burning of the peat forests throughout tropical Southeast Asia creates significant haze pollution that poses significant challenges to human health and the economies of the region. A government-sponsored transmigration program fueled the boom of oil palm farming, and local minorities were displaced. Scientists, government officials, local farmers, and displaced minorities present their conflicting points of view.
